#11 Not sure what technology you guys are using for maintaining links, but for example, if you break a page up into two pages, there's an easy method for maintaining links to appropriate content across pages:
If you're using server-side scripting you can create a "bridge" page that maintains all the links. Then when you want to link to a specific term, you link to the bridge. The bridge has a pointer to the actual location of the content.
So it works like this:
Link -> goes to bridge, bridge redirects to -> Actual Content
This way, you can change the bridge reference whenever you need to break up a page without creating a 404-erroring link on every page that the changed link was on. All of your game term links then look like:
[a href="BridgePage.php?term=ArmorClass"]Armor Class[/a]
